Special Features & Unique Opportunities
Located in the beautiful Thousand Islands region of upstate New York. Residents get excellent hands-on training in both inpatient & outpatient medicine. Continuity clinic experience is considered one of our strong points by program graduates. Rotation work is one-on-one with attendings. Protected didactics: resident facilitated case presentations, grand rounds & Wednesday academic afternoon. Tight-knit group that work & play hard together. SMC is accredited by the ACGME .
